Quick Facts — Orleans town
- What is the median household income in Orleans town?
-
The median household income in Orleans town is $64,504 (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 5-Year Estimates, 2023).
- What is the poverty rate in Orleans town?
-
The poverty rate in Orleans town is 11.6% (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
- What is the median home value in Orleans town?
-
$109,900 (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
- What is the average rent in Orleans town?
-
The median gross rent in Orleans town is $817 per month (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
- What percentage of Orleans town residents have a college degree?
-
10.0% of adults in Orleans town hold a bachelor's degree or higher (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
